West Bengal Civil Service (Judicial) Examination

Age: Not less than 23 years and not more than 35 years on the date of advertisement for the examination.

Educational Qualifications:


   1. A degree in Law from any University or Institution affiliated to a University recognized by the State Government or the Central Government;
   2. Enrolment as an advocate in the roll of Bar Council of any State or Union Territory in India on the date of advertisement for the examination; (iii) Ability to read, write and speak in Bengali (not required for recruitment in the case of Nepali speaking candidates from hill areas of the district of Darjeeling).
